To start, reflect on the design of your laundry room. Smart utilization of space is crucial, especially in more compact areas. I find that stacking the washer and dryer creates floor space, providing me space for additional storage or a folding station. Should space allows, integrating a countertop on top of parallel appliances provides a useful surface for folding clothes directly after using the dryer.

Storage is another critical element to focus on. Cabinets and shelves can keep cleaning supplies, detergents, and other necessities organized and close at hand. In my experience, using marked baskets or bins on open shelves gives a organized, cohesive look that keeps everything in its place. Should your laundry room has minimal space, wall-mounted cabinets can provide additional storage without taking up important floor space.

Adding a sink to your laundry room might be a game changer. It’s ideal for handwashing special care items or managing stains before washing. Should plumbing is feasible, I suggest adding a deep utility sink that manages larger tasks, like soaking items or cleaning tools.

Lighting also plays a vital role in making the space functional. Proper task lighting ensures you are able to see what you’re handling when sorting, folding, or addressing stains. Under-cabinet lighting is a great option for illuminating work surfaces, while a ceiling fixture can offer overall lighting for the room.

Lastly, don’t forget to inject some personality in your laundry room. A fresh coat of paint, fun wallpaper, or decorative accents can make the space feel more pleasant. I appreciate including touches like artwork, plants, or even a stylish rug to introduce warmth and character to the room.
